[In this question the horizontal unit vectors i\mathbf{i}i and j\mathbf{j}j are due east and due north respectively.]
A model boat A A\,A moves on a lake with constant velocity (−i+6j) m s−1(-\mathbf{i} + 6\mathbf{j}) \text{ m s}^{-1}(−i+6j) m s−1. At time t=0t = 0t=0, A A\,A is at the point with position vector (2i−10j) m(2\mathbf{i} - 10\mathbf{j}) \text{ m}(2i−10j) m.
Find the speed of AAA.
Find the direction in which A A\,A is moving, giving your answer as a bearing.
At time t=0t = 0t=0, a second boat B B\,B is at the point with position vector (−26i+4j) m(-26\mathbf{i} + 4\mathbf{j}) \text{ m}(−26i+4j) m. Given that the velocity of B B\,B is (3i+4j) m s−1(3\mathbf{i} + 4\mathbf{j}) \text{ m s}^{-1}(3i+4j) m s−1, show that A A\,A and B B\,B will collide at a point P P\,P and find the position vector of PPP.
Given instead that B B\,B has speed 8 m s-1 and moves in the direction of the vector (3i+4j)(3\mathbf{i} + 4\mathbf{j})(3i+4j), find the distance of B B\,B from P P\,P when t=7 st = 7 \text{ s}t=7 s.
